To use cruise control in your Honda Civic 2019, start by activating the feature. Look for the cruise control buttons on the steering wheel, typically located on the right side. Press the "Cruise" or "On/Off" button to turn on the cruise control system. Once activated, you can set your desired speed by using the "+" and "-" buttons. The cruise control will maintain your selected speed until you press the brake pedal or turn off the system.

The History and Myth of Cruise Control
Cruise control has become a staple feature in modern vehicles, including the Honda Civic 2019. However, its origins can be traced back to the 1940s. Ralph Teetor, an engineer who was blind, is credited with inventing the first cruise control system. He came up with the idea while riding in a car with his lawyer, who had a habit of speeding up and slowing down.
Contrary to popular belief, cruise control does not increase the risk of accidents. In fact, when used responsibly, it can enhance safety by helping drivers maintain a constant speed and focus on the road. However, it's important to remember that cruise control should only be used in appropriate driving conditions and should never replace the driver's attentiveness.
As technology continues to advance, cruise control systems are becoming more advanced and sophisticated. Some modern vehicles even offer adaptive cruise control, which can automatically adjust the speed to maintain a safe following distance from the vehicle ahead.

Recommendations for Using Cruise Control
When using cruise control in your Honda Civic 2019, there are a few recommendations to keep in mind. First, always use cruise control on open highways with minimal traffic. Avoid using it in heavy traffic or urban areas, as you'll need to have full control of your vehicle at all times.
Second, be mindful of your surroundings and adjust your speed accordingly. If you encounter adverse weather conditions or a sudden change in traffic, it's important to reduce your speed manually and take control of your vehicle.
Lastly, always stay alert and be prepared to take over control if necessary. Cruise control is a helpful tool, but it should never replace the driver's attentiveness. Always be aware of your surroundings, follow traffic regulations, and be ready to react to any unexpected situations.
